GSSI SIR 2000
A portable, digital Subsurface Interface Radar System designed for a broad range of applications concerning the fields of civil engineering, construction, geology, hydrogeology, archeology and environmental protection. It is currently equipped with a 400 MHz and a 40 MHz antennas.

Antenna Model 5103

Used for moderately shallow investigations and is ideally suited for utility detection, underground storage tank locating and void identification. (400 MHz)
Antenna SubEcho-40

Very High Penetration, 35 MHz Ground Probing Radar Antenna
The SubEcho-40 is a low frequency, portable lightweight antenna with very high penetration. The antenna is perfectly matched, so it does not have to be in contact with the surveyed media. Even airborne surveys can be performed with good results. One man surveys with one or two antennas are possible, even in hard terrain. The elements and electronics are all embedded in armed fiber-glass, making the antenna waterproof. The antenna is delivered with four universal fastening points and shoulder strap. Optional is two glass fiber rods for winch mounting and basic operation
